zoukankan      html  css  js  c++  java
  • ubuntu设置系统时间与网络时间同步和时区


    Linux的时间分为System Clock(系统时间)和Real Time Clock (硬件时间,简称RTC)。

    系统时间:指当前Linux Kernel中的时间。

    硬件时间:主板上有电池供电的时间。

    查看系统时间的命令: #date

    设置系统时间的命令: #date –set(月/日/年 时:分:秒)

    例:#date –set “10/11/10 10:15”

    查看硬件时间的命令: # hwclock

    设置硬件时间的命令: # hwclock –set –date = (月/日/年 时:分:秒)

    上述提到的是手动设置时间到一个时间点,可能与当前网络的时间有误差。下面介绍一下与时间服务器上的时间同步的方法

    1.  安装ntpdate工具

    # sudo apt-get install ntpdate

    2.  设置系统时间与网络时间同步

    # ntpdate cn.pool.ntp.org

    3.  将系统时间写入硬件时间

    # hwclock --systohc


    时区修改

    1.首先查看时区:

    swfsadmin@swfsubuntu:~$ date -R
    Tue, 17 Dec 2013 18:23:01 +0800

    如果要修改时区,执行sudo tzselect

    2.选择区域:亚洲

    复制代码
    swfsadmin@swfsubuntu:~$ sudo tzselect
    [sudo] password for swfsadmin: 
    Sorry, try again.
    [sudo] password for swfsadmin: 
    Please identify a location so that time zone rules can be set correctly.
    Please select a continent or ocean.
     1) Africa
     2) Americas
     3) Antarctica
     4) Arctic Ocean
     5) Asia
     6) Atlantic Ocean
     7) Australia
     8) Europe
     9) Indian Ocean
    10) Pacific Ocean
    11) none - I want to specify the time zone using the Posix TZ format.
    #? 5
    复制代码

    3.选择国家:中国

    复制代码
    Please select a country.
     1) Afghanistan           18) Israel                35) Palestine
     2) Armenia               19) Japan                 36) Philippines
     3) Azerbaijan            20) Jordan                37) Qatar
     4) Bahrain               21) Kazakhstan            38) Russia
     5) Bangladesh            22) Korea (North)         39) Saudi Arabia
     6) Bhutan                23) Korea (South)         40) Singapore
     7) Brunei                24) Kuwait                41) Sri Lanka
     8) Cambodia              25) Kyrgyzstan            42) Syria
     9) China                 26) Laos                  43) Taiwan
    10) Cyprus                27) Lebanon               44) Tajikistan
    11) East Timor            28) Macau                 45) Thailand
    12) Georgia               29) Malaysia              46) Turkmenistan
    13) Hong Kong             30) Mongolia              47) United Arab Emirates
    14) India                 31) Myanmar (Burma)       48) Uzbekistan
    15) Indonesia             32) Nepal                 49) Vietnam
    16) Iran                  33) Oman                  50) Yemen
    17) Iraq                  34) Pakistan
    #? 9
    复制代码

    4.选择时区:北京时间

    复制代码
    Please select one of the following time zone regions.
    1) east China - Beijing, Guangdong, Shanghai, etc.
    2) Heilongjiang (except Mohe), Jilin
    3) central China - Sichuan, Yunnan, Guangxi, Shaanxi, Guizhou, etc.
    4) most of Tibet & Xinjiang
    5) west Tibet & Xinjiang
    #? 1
    复制代码

    5.确认验证:

    复制代码
    The following information has been given:
    
            China
            east China - Beijing, Guangdong, Shanghai, etc.
    
    Therefore TZ='Asia/Shanghai' will be used.
    Local time is now:      Tue Dec 17 18:22:10 CST 2013.
    Universal Time is now:  Tue Dec 17 10:22:10 UTC 2013.
    Is the above information OK?
    1) Yes
    2) No
    #? 1
    
    You can make this change permanent for yourself by appending the line
            TZ='Asia/Shanghai'; export TZ
    to the file '.profile' in your home directory; then log out and log in again.
    
    Here is that TZ value again, this time on standard output so that you
    can use the /usr/bin/tzselect command in shell scripts:
    Asia/Shanghai
    复制代码
    6.复制文件到/etc目录下
    sudo cp /usr/share/zoneinfo/Asia/Shanghai  /etc/localtime
    7.更新时间
    sudo ntpdate time.windows.com

    改时间参考:

    http://5154091.blog.hexun.com/30735220_d.html

    修改时间

    sudo date -s MM/DD/YY //修改日期
    sudo date -s hh:mm:ss //修改时间

    在修改时间以后,修改硬件CMOS的时间

    sudo hwclock --systohc //非常重要,如果没有这一步的话,后面时间还是不准

    http://www.cnblogs.com/php5/archive/2011/02/15/1955432.html

    http://os.51cto.com/art/200908/142234.htm

  • 相关阅读:
    Windows Server 2003 R2 IIS服务的命令行方式重启命令
    DWZ学习记录--关闭loading效果
    td顶部对齐
    struts2 iterator 迭代标签只显示前五条记录
    struts2 select 默认选中
    struts2 select标签
    s:select 标签中list存放map对象的使用
    struts2中<s:select>标签的使用
    eclipse在Windows7 64 位下出现Unhandled event loop exception No more handles
    Jquery焦点图/幻灯片效果 插件 KinSlideshow
  • 原文地址:https://www.cnblogs.com/ld1226/p/5415822.html
Copyright © 2011-2022 走看看